When The Property needs a ton of work
And You have no clue where to start
You start here

Copyright 2024 TRH New York

Embedded Software & Firmware Growth Solutions

These purposes are embedded software program for smart lighting systems, thermostats, safety cameras, door locks, voice assistants, etc. Embedded software program improvement performs a big position within the vitality sector, enabling its scale and digital transformation. The demand for sensible power storage and management techniques is rising amongst governmental services and private businesses. Embedded software is a particular program designed and integrated inside an embedded system to execute specific tasks. It is integrated into a tool’s hardware and makes it operational, offering the required performance for this gadget.

We assess if the product requires a consumer display and design a user-friendly interface if needed. While the product’s architecture is designed, we tackle key issues like performance and internet connectivity. Embedded systems developers should have a portfolio that reveals successful design and development tasks related to the one you are hiring them to carry out. Whether you need customized embedded system growth, system integration, or upkeep and updates, there are important benefits to hiring an expert embedded systems developer.

Here are the key particulars to grasp when working with an embedded methods improvement service. Here is a have a look at the different parts you’ll find a way to expect an embedded methods growth service to offer. Embedded methods have different features and capabilities depending on the kind of tools or system. The packages typically want to respond in actual time to variables and constraints and performance with available knowledge and resources.

embedded software development solutions

Hence, to simplify the event process, it’s extremely beneficial to make use of built-in environments. A compiler is a tool for transforming the code right into a low-level machine language code — the one that a machine can perceive. A text editor is the primary tool you want to start creating an embedded system. It is used to put in writing source code in programming languages C and C++ and save this code as a textual content file.

But it might be extremely inconvenient to make use of them separately, including another layer of complexity to the project. Embedded software program growth providers can encompass various activities, including software program and firmware development, hardware design, system integration, testing and validation, and ongoing maintenance and help. If any bugs arise, we can repair them immediately and add any new functionality upon request. We undertake feasibility studies for brand new embedded options, and guarantee product viability via performance tuning as nicely as enhancements throughout the product lifecycle. Our automation platforms scale back cycle time to enrich options of existing embedded systems. Significantly, our AI-driven root cause evaluation instruments and predictive analytics solutions supply contextual insights to handle gaps in functional requirements, together with safety and quality.

Programming, Optimization, And Firmware For Microprocessor Units

In our complicated embedded software growth companies, we take a personalised method, tailoring options to meet your particular needs. Our staff works intently with you to know your market objectives, allowing us to ship a product that aligns with your goals and offers the mandatory performance and efficiency. Embedded systems have turn out to be an integral part of many businesses and industries. They allow the automation of complex processes, increase effectivity, and enhance safety and safety. Although somewhat rarer right now with the prevalence of frameworks and libraries that allow embedded systems programmers to make use of high-level languages, the improvement process may typically contain writing low-level code. The term refers to programming that provides directions on to the processing hardware with little to no abstraction.

A linker is a software that mixes all these items together, making a single executable program. Geany supports C, Java, PHP, HTML, Python, Perl, Pascal and different forms of recordsdata. An embedded system is a mix of a hardware module and a software module.

embedded software development solutions

Some duties embedded systems execute inside varied devices are performance monitoring and management, data assortment and processing, together with encryption, power management, and stable communication. Embedded techniques development companies allow companies to customise their software and hardware to meet specific needs. This implies that firms can develop options tailor-made to their unique requirements. The gadgets embedded methods inhabit can range from simple client electronics to advanced industrial management systems. Developers would possibly create and integrate an entire system or carry out a selected task to automate, enhance, or streamline existing embedded methods.

An embedded TCP/IP solution that optimizes knowledge transfer for drilling tools and reduces downtime. The code and hardware optimization resulted in faster knowledge transfer—11 minutes, which is a 300% improvement over the original solution. Softeq has been extremely good at developing for each iOS and Android gadgets, and coordinating that with the integration embedded software development solutions of the net app. We hit the deadline proper on time, which was exceedingly spectacular to me and uncommon within the software enterprise. I assume any start-up that’s trying to construct their first hardware product and doesn’t have all the expertise in house, should contemplate working with Softeq.

Board Assist Bundle Development

As an Avnet firm, we perceive hardware and focus on software program – so we will provide the best of both worlds. We think about both short and long-term targets and usher in our brightest minds from across the embedded software skillset to help cover each consequence and leave no stone unturned. Ideation and Planning Experts start with brainstorming the embedded product’s want, contemplating its potential advantages and cost-effectiveness.

embedded software development solutions

In addition to skills and experience with the type of embedded systems your company requires, you want your embedded software program improvement service to have particular qualities. We work on options that improve coaching and prevent damage, including initiatives for skilled sports, fitness, and rehabilitation. Depending on the project, we equip gadgets with different connectivity solutions—RFID, GPS/GIS, or Bluetooth.

What Makes Itrex The Right Embedded Software Company To Deal With Your Project?

Selecting a suitable set of growth tools for your embedded system is dependent upon the project requirements, scope, and specifics. However, you don’t have to determine independently, and you’ll delegate embedded applied sciences choice to your embedded software program development companion. Embedded systems https://www.globalcloudteam.com/ growth providers might help improve the effectivity of an embedded system by optimising its hardware and software program elements. This may find yourself in sooner processing times, reduced power consumption, and improved system responsiveness.

embedded software development solutions

We also invite you to study extra details about how we delivered firmware for ID playing cards resolution by Chrome Roads that applies to multiple industries. The breadth of information and understanding that ELEKS has within its partitions allows us to leverage that expertise to make superior deliverables for our prospects. When you work with ELEKS, you’re working with the highest 1% of the aptitude and engineering excellence of the entire nation. In addition, Softeq presents hands-on expertise with a number of Android TV options, having delivered them for Samsung, Philips, and Sony Smart TV Android-powered platforms. We commonly comply with Agile greatest practices and use Scrum and Kanban methodologies in our work process.

Use Circumstances Of Embedded Software Development In Different Industries

As an ISO complaint firm, we prioritize functional security in automotive embedded software development, because it ensures driver security and vehicle operability. To choose the tech stack and growth instruments appropriate on your embedded software project, it is crucial to determine the hardware and software program specifications that have to be met. Based on this information, embedded engineers will be ready to outline the project scope, required applied sciences, and specialists to complete the project from A to Z, together with time and value estimates. Embedded systems are used to develop units in nearly all industries, together with medical gadgets, wearables, automotive options, good house systems, and industrial equipment. These systems enable businesses to handle their inside processes remotely and extra effectively, save costs, and attain business goals with anticipated operational efficiency. An embedded system consists of embedded software program that performs particular duties, and hardware, such as a microcontroller or microprocessor, that operates thanks to integrated software program.

embedded software development solutions

We’ve boiled down 20 years of information into the three key consulting areas that we see system makers battle with time and time once more. We work with in style embedded Linux distros together with Buildroot, Yocto, Ubuntu, Debian, OpenWRT, Linux Mint. The Softeq staff carried out a complete R&D session and manufactured a sample of a brand new laser-powered gadget for tracking, monitoring, video recording and streaming sports activities.

Softeq created an HMI to assist equipment operators interface with stretch wrappers and re-engineered the embedded software that the tools was running on. Our QA division participates in the development course of from the earliest stages to ensure complete testing coverage and correct high quality assessment. We assure total transparency into the method and progress of your project. Our expertise serving 1,200 purchasers from 30+ industries permits us to rapidly find a technically optimal resolution to each company’s particular challenges. We develop high-performance electronics based on fashionable SoCs and ARM Cortex-A sequence processors for numerous software fields.

The simplest of the embedded software program examples is a traditional calculator that was used earlier than this characteristic was built into smartphones. Technical Specifications and Design Engineers create detailed technical specs, serving as a development roadmap.

Worth To Your Buyer By Leveraging Particular Person Specialists Or Whole Groups Of

The partnership contributed to SNOO’s extremely profitable launch, which has since gained several awards, including CES 2017 Best of Baby Tech & Safety and the 2017 BIG Innovation Award. We collect and course of your embedded system project requirements, endeavor complete research and analysis on the early levels to mitigate project risks. A good debugger device is IDA Pro that works on Linux, Windows and Mac OS X working techniques. It has both free and business variations and is extremely popular among builders. So feel free to share your embedded software requests with us so we are in a position to rapidly develop an actionable plan. To say a quantity of extra words about wearable gadgets in healthcare, they’ve formally turn into one of the methods of remote affected person well being monitoring and generally remedy.

In addition, embedded options are developed considering environmental factors similar to temperature or humidity that may affect units and affect their efficiency. Our embedded software development with a profound exposure to SOC solutions, addresses Product development holistically, thereby facilitating a higher worth proposition. Embedded software is broadly used for a quantity of purposes, particularly for good residence options.

Alessandro Dev

About Alessandro Dev


Leave a Comment

This offers you the chance to try out different games without risking your personal money. qabul Follow the instructions to reset it and create a new Mostbet casino login. mostbet uz yuklab olish In one click, you will be able to gain access to the casino services. mostbet Once you open the installation file, the system will automatically request permission to install from an unknown source. mostbet uz yuklab olish